On the International Commercial Law and Arbitration with Placement Year programme from University of Hertfordshire You’ll study two compulsory modules: International Commercial Arbitration and International Commercial Law (your compulsory module).
Key facts
- International Commercial Law covers topics such as the choice of law and jurisdiction clauses, the different types of international contracts and their respective implications for the parties involved, the international conventions applicable to international commerce, shipping law, the role of documentation, and finance and marine insurance.
- The International Commercial Arbitration module will examine arbitration as an alternative means of alternative dispute resolution. The role and appointment of arbitrators, arbitral awards, the arbitral procedure and the challenges to the recognition and enforcement of foreign arbitral awards are some of the topics you will study.
